当前位置: 首页 > news >正文

STM32[笔记]--4.嵌入式硬件基础

4.嵌入式硬件基础

4.1认识上官二号开发板

  • 主控芯片:STM32F103C8T6
  • 高速晶振:8M
  • 低速晶振:32.768k
  • LED:5颗
  • KEY:3个
    主控芯片内部的资源如下
项目介绍
内核Cortex-M3
Flsah64K*8bit
SRAM20K*8bit
GPIO37个GPIO,分别为PA0-PB15,PC13-PC15,PD0-PD1
ADC2个12bitADC合计12了通道,外部通道:PA0到PA7+PB0到PB1内部通道:温度传感器通道ADC——Channel_16和内部参考电压通道ADC——Channel_17
定时器/计数器4个bit定时器/计数器,分别为TIM1,TIM2,TIM3,TIM4,TIM1带入死区插入,常用于产生PWM控制电机
看门狗定时器2个看门狗定时器(独立看门狗WDG,窗口看门狗WWDG)
滴答定时器1个24bt向下计数的滴答定时器systick
工作电压,温度2V~3.6V,-40摄氏度到85摄氏度
串口通信2IIC,2SPI,3USART,1CAN
系统时钟内部8MHz时钟HSI最高可倍频到64MHz,外部8MHZ时钟HSE最高可倍调到72MHZ

4.2STM32F103C8T6引脚分布

引脚定义在芯片手册的第17页,

  • 因为芯片手册是STM32F103系列的芯片的手册所以首先看表格的左上角需要找到芯片对应的分装类型,然后看对应的列(我们的是LQFP48封装类型的)。
  • 封装名称对应的列就是引脚的编号。
  • 然后表格右边一行就是引脚的名称。
  • 下一列是引脚的类型,在表格的最下面有类型的解释(I=输入,O=输出,S=电源,HiZ=高阻)。
  • 下一列是电平,FI代表:容忍5V,如果没有FT的引脚输入5V,芯片就有可能会烧掉。
  • 下一列
http://www.lryc.cn/news/574648.html

相关文章:

  • 攻防世界-MISC-MeowMeowMeow
  • Unity小工具:资源引用的检索和替换
  • 深入研究:小红书笔记详情API接口详解
  • Linux环境下MariaDB如何实现负载均衡
  • 一文了解AI Agent的幕后基础设施
  • 记一次 Kafka 磁盘被写满的排查经历
  • 采用ArcGIS10.8.2 进行插值图绘制
  • macOS - 快速上手使用 YOLO
  • MySQL之SQL性能优化策略
  • 信创建设,如何统一管理异构服务器的认证、密码、权限管理等?
  • React性能优化精髓之一:频繁setState导致滚动卡顿的解决方案
  • 新增MCP接入和AutoAgent,汉得灵猿AI中台1.6版正式发布!
  • 【软考高级系统架构论文】论单元测试方法及应用
  • Linux离线安装mysql
  • 探秘深蓝 “引擎”:解码水下推进器的科技与应用
  • Flask(四) 模板渲染render_template
  • Dify×奇墨科技:开源+本土化,破解企业AI落地难题
  • Chrome MCP Server:AI驱动浏览器自动化测试实战「喂饭教程」
  • iframe窗体默认白色背景去除
  • 重点解析(软件工程)
  • 云电脑,“死”于AI时代前夕 | 数智化观察
  • 基于DE1-SoC的My_First_oneAPI(二)
  • 黑马Day01-03集开始
  • 第24篇:Linux内核深度解析与OpenEuler 24.03实践指南
  • TCP/UDP协议深度解析(一):UDP特性与TCP确认应答以及重传机制
  • 交易期权先从买方开始
  • C8BJWD8BJV美光固态闪存HSA22HSA29
  • android脱糖
  • Kubernetes生命周期管理:深入理解 Pod 生命周期
  • python有哪些常用的GUI(图形用户界面)库及选择指南